Surface Preparation & Paint Correction
Before applying any coating, we perform a full exterior wash, decontamination (iron removal, tar removal, clay bar), and if required, machine‑polish correction to eliminate swirl marks, haze and light defects. Proper prep ensures the coating bonds and performs at its best.

What a Ceramic Coating Does
Forms a durable molecular bond with the paint, creating a slick, hydrophobic surface that repels water, dirt and contaminants.
Protects against UV rays, oxidation, chemical etching and the elements—helping preserve the brilliance of your paint.
Enhances gloss and depth of finish so your vehicle stands out and stays looking newer for longer.
Reduces maintenance time and effort: fewer washes, faster clean-ups and improved durability over traditional waxes.

XPEL FUSION PLUS Ceramic Coating
XPEL FUSION PLUS is a single layer application 9h hardness ceramic coating developed to be installed on Paint Protection Film and painted surfaces. FUSION PLUS offers a thin layer of added protection against UV, oxidation, bug acids, road contaminants, and is resistant to stains and chemical etching from oils and other environmental pollutants that your vehicle sees every day on the open road.
Features:
Hydrophobic Properties: Fusion Plus repels water, making it easier to wash your vehicle and preventing water spots.
UV Protection: It protects the paint from harmful UV rays that can cause fading and oxidation.
Scratch Resistance: The coating adds a layer of protection against light scratches and swirl marks.
Chemical Resistance: It offers resistance to various chemicals, including road salts and other contaminants, helping to maintain the integrity of the vehicle's finish.
Longevity: Fusion Plus is designed to last for several years with proper maintenance, making it a cost-effective solution over time.
Enhanced Gloss: It enhances the depth and gloss of the vehicle's paint, giving it a more vibrant and polished appearance.
Self-Healing Properties: Minor scratches can "heal" over time with heat exposure, making the coating look better longer.

PPF provides a physical barrier that protects against rock chips, scratches, and impacts, while ceramic coatings are liquid polymers that offer chemical protection (from contaminants like dirt, grime, and water). They can be used together for maximum protection.

Yes, ceramic coating can be removed, but it requires professional-grade products or a machine polish to take it off completely. It's not as simple as removing wax.
 
- 
      
        
          
        
      
      
Ceramic coatings offer hydrophobic properties, meaning water beads up and rolls off, reducing the chances of water spots. However, if water is left to dry on the surface, mineral deposits can still form.
